From Lendingclub Corp's Latest SEC 10-K Filing (filed 2026-02-12)
Key Strengths & Strategy (as disclosed to the SEC)
- LendingClub Corporation, operates as a bank holding company, that provides range of financial products and services in the United States.
- It offers deposit products, including savings accounts, checking accounts, and certificates of deposit; patient and education finance loans; and commercial loans, including small business loans.
- The company also provides consumer loans, such as Unsecured and unsecured, fixed-rate, and fixed-term consumer loans; and secured auto refinance loans.
- In addition, it operates a lending marketplace platform.
